  Fond Memories

  

Those Memories Still Remain

I lived in Hoboken, so we were always at the Park, especially in the Summer for the Pool and the big lemons with the ice cold lemonade.....the Shows, Tunnel of Love, the Fat Lady Laughing in my minds eye, I can still see it and hear the sounds.......

I was also in the fire in 44, I can remember my Dad holding me and my sister in the pool until the wires started to fall, I remember a Fireman carrying me down a ladder covered with his raincoat, down the Palisades.....

I was only 5 but those memories still remain.......

Fr. George McBride
